RSS   



  可打印版本 | 推薦給朋友 | 訂閱主題 | 收藏主題 | 純文字版  


 


 
主題: [其他] [問題]關於網頁架構的問題   字型大小:||| 
ROACH
版主
等級: 30等級: 30等級: 30等級: 30等級: 30等級: 30等級: 30等級: 30
減肥中!請勿餵食

十週年紀念徽章(四級)  

 . 積分: 15118
 . 精華: 14
 . 文章: 11766
 . 收花: 140844 支
 . 送花: 6005 支
 . 比例: 0.04
 . 在線: 8869 小時
 . 瀏覽: 85616 頁
 . 註冊: 7994
 . 失蹤: 7
 . 鄉下地方
#1 : 2007-1-12 11:42 PM     只看本作者 引言回覆

今天跟我的主管討論
我做的一個企業內部網站

因為我整個網頁用的大量的iframe的方式~
反正點選單就把目標就指到那個iframe的名子然後底下的iframe就載入網頁
對我這個程式開發者在方便也不過的


可是我主管一看到,他表示他很不喜歡我用這種方式
他說這樣的話~上面的網址列都看不到那些參數,如果朋友要某個網頁裡面的內容
要怎給他網址,且現在很多網站的趨勢也很少有人用iframe




我主管不是專門寫程式的人~他專長在網路系統方面的

我一頭霧水一臉茫然用iframe不是比較安全嗎?
又看不到傳送的參數也不用去考慮到一些
且~每次網頁上面是選單下面是網頁內容
如果用一般的網頁寫作方式
不是標題以及目錄幾乎在每個網頁都要重新勘入讀取近來
為什麼不直接用iframe的方式把內容網頁載入進來就好

可是他終究是我主管~且我一時也不知道怎解釋
我只好說!!我會去研究好好想想


後來我晚上到YAHOO還有看大部分網頁以及討論區的架構
好像也很少有人用iframe

大部分好像都是一整個網頁
然後到處點來點去都可以在網址列看到相關參數跟內容
直接整個頁面載入另一個網頁
為什麼呢??iframe真的那麼不好嗎???


假如我不用iframe的方式
那假如我的架構是那種~~
上面有目錄~下面有內容~~
假如目錄有五個目錄選項
那是不是代表這五個網頁的最上頭都要包含include『目錄選項』的網頁語法呢

想想看還是那種只要寫一個頭網頁下面用iframe
然後底下那五個都不用寫『目錄選項』程式來的好


大家覺得呢????

唉~當mis程式設計師當久的
每天面對的就是公司的網頁及程式
總覺得有點封閉
都不知道外面的技術是怎樣



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  訪問主頁  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
steven211
開墾隊隊員
等級: 4


今日心情

 . 積分: 32
 . 文章: 64
 . 收花: 167 支
 . 送花: 131 支
 . 比例: 0.78
 . 在線: 338 小時
 . 瀏覽: 5290 頁
 . 註冊: 6910
 . 失蹤: 2714
#2 : 2007-1-29 07:32 PM     只看本作者 引言回覆

這種東西實在是見人見志,
intranet說實在的也不需要多麼漂亮的介面iframe還是很好用的,
例如配合javascript指定iframe的style可以做工具列的縮放等等,
提昇應用程式的可用性又可以節省版面,
另外這個IT主管實在是有夠低逃,
企業內資訊化是為了節省人力,
不是因為他的個人喜好又增加了額外的IT支出,
適合當主管嗎?



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
GERRYccc
名譽版主
等級: 8等級: 8
凹~~嗚~~^^y

今日心情

 . 積分: 103
 . 文章: 597
 . 收花: 497 支
 . 送花: 754 支
 . 比例: 1.52
 . 在線: 446 小時
 . 瀏覽: 7391 頁
 . 註冊: 7995
 . 失蹤: 148
 . ~@.@~ TWed2k 星球
#3 : 2007-2-2 03:07 PM     只看本作者 引言回覆

可以考慮用 flash 做 bar…flash下載一次後會暫存…這樣應該就能很快了。


[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
stanleyh
青銅驢友
等級: 11等級: 11等級: 11等級: 11
很煩...

 . 積分: 250
 . 文章: 307
 . 收花: 2289 支
 . 送花: 573 支
 . 比例: 0.25
 . 在線: 643 小時
 . 瀏覽: 3860 頁
 . 註冊: 7220
 . 失蹤: 878
#4 : 2007-2-12 03:26 PM     只看本作者 引言回覆

即然是企業內部網站...應該是不提供外部存取..
那比較不需考慮安全性...而是資訊的表現方式...
怎麼利用這些資訊..來表現各部門的特色及資訊..
可以更生動活潑...端視貴公司建立內部網站的主要目的為何..
而且即然是要利用網站來公開資訊...
鎖的太複雜...對開發者是很大的負擔...
有機密性的資訊可考慮不放或是設定權限閱讀...



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
rakish
鐵驢友〔初級〕
等級: 4


 . 積分: 20
 . 文章: 81
 . 收花: 65 支
 . 送花: 37 支
 . 比例: 0.57
 . 在線: 459 小時
 . 瀏覽: 7020 頁
 . 註冊: 7222
 . 失蹤: 1206
 . taiwan
#5 : 2007-2-13 11:59 PM     只看本作者 引言回覆

iframe 為什不用...

我覺得是因為 網路頻寬提升了 ..
沒必要再把共用的部分分開
重新 Roload 就可以了 ..

用了 iframe 以後...滑鼠滾輪會變的怪怪的
如果調整 字形大小或螢幕解析度以後 Iframe 的 bar 會怪怪的

另外我覺得最大的原因是 CSS 太強了...
甚至是可以已自訂 Tag
就可以達到很多效果了...



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
jocosn
白銀驢友
等級: 15等級: 15等級: 15等級: 15等級: 15


今日心情

 . 積分: 1386
 . 精華: 2
 . 文章: 2945
 . 收花: 9537 支
 . 送花: 3671 支
 . 比例: 0.38
 . 在線: 1295 小時
 . 瀏覽: 19041 頁
 . 註冊: 7236
 . 失蹤: 1238
#6 : 2007-2-21 06:15 AM     只看本作者 引言回覆

據我以往的的經驗與研究所知,
貴公司主管說的:「網址列都看不到那些參數,如果朋友要某個網頁裡面的內容
要怎給他網址,且現在很多網站的趨勢也很少有人用iframe」
據國外與網路上有所謂的網頁趨勢,iframe 相對上用的不多,
不過還是要懷疑調查的準確信與可靠性。
因為 flash 做的網站,你也看不到網址列有什麼東西,
但是 FLASH 網站還是有一大堆,是什麼原因?


但是,既然是企業內部網站,要告訴哪個朋友某個網頁裡面的內容?
對方有辦法存取嗎?
如果是內部員工,你可以自己"烤"&傳&轉出PDF等等給他阿。
解決方法很多,怎會只有一種方法?
怎可把自己的偷懶藉口怪在別人身上?

至於五個網頁的最上頭都要包含include『目錄選項』的網頁語法,
要 include 進去的東西 browser 存取一次就行,可能問題不太大。
如果嫌打字或 COPY太麻煩,做個範本或模版為套用標準即可,問題也不大。

我是覺得 iframe 這種東西,
可能用在點選網頁內容中的某部份連結(非網頁導覽選單)後,某小區塊的東西會產生變更。
例如點選導覽選單的產品區,該網頁左下方出現一堆產品縮圖,點縮圖後右下方出現大圖,右下方用 iframe 做(我之前遇到這個問題一開始是用 iframe,後來發現外觀較不好控制,後來改用 div 配合 CSS 的 overflow 做),
類似這樣的解決方案,跟拷貝網址寄EMAIL給對方差不了多少,直接打電話口述(時間快)告訴對方點產品區後第幾張縮圖。
不然網站一大,像 Yahoo,網址列後面參數一堆,到底考漏了沒也不知道,也維護困難。
這種方式還有個好處,我只要一張產品 HTML 網頁就可以了,維護較容易,也不需抓 GET 參數。


至於"標題以及目錄幾乎在每個網頁都要重新勘入讀取近來",這好像可以用 Ajax 克服,大大之前不是有研究 Ajax,OK 的

[jocosn 在  2007-2-23 05:29 PM 作了最後編輯]



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
shark
鍛鐵驢友
等級: 7等級: 7等級: 7
用戶被禁止發言

 . 積分: 83
 . 文章: 72
 . 收花: 306 支
 . 送花: 3241 支
 . 比例: 10.59
 . 在線: 167 小時
 . 瀏覽: 9561 頁
 . 註冊: 6730
 . 失蹤: 3956
#7 : 2007-2-25 04:49 AM     只看本作者 引言回覆

正所謂條條大路通羅馬,需要使用什麼方法完成,因該每個人都有自己偏好的方法與理由,我想最重要的是最後能夠滿足要求就可以了,至於頂頭上司能不能點的通,就只能看運氣啦!

不過對於 iframe 我到有些看法,我想這玩意之所以無法被成為主流,最主要還是因為它的相容性,因為這是 IE 瀏覽器使用的技術,看來微軟應該還沒有強勢到能讓所有人都只使用 IE 吧!那麼為了維持更大的相容性,避免使用這種技術就成了一種不錯的選擇。

而且我個人也建議,還是不用為妙吧!不是因為什麼特殊的原因,只是省得到時被人拿來當骨頭在雞蛋裡挑,因為你永遠沒辦法知道這種人啥時才會出現...



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
桂正和
銀驢友〔初級〕
等級: 12等級: 12等級: 12
論壇第一窮

今日心情

 . 積分: 448
 . 文章: 777
 . 收花: 3245 支
 . 送花: 1392 支
 . 比例: 0.43
 . 在線: 1624 小時
 . 瀏覽: 33426 頁
 . 註冊: 7803
 . 失蹤: 1245
 . 台灣
#8 : 2007-2-26 10:04 PM     只看本作者 引言回覆

以個人觀感看
其實對使用者來說
很多時候內置框架或者是iframe真的不是很方便使用
早期用這類作法通常都是以美觀為主的網站居多

至於所謂的防止他人Try參數這類的問題
我覺得程式撰寫人員本身就該避免程式上的漏洞
畢竟就算用了內置框架或者是iframe
還是有方式找出來目標網頁
真的有心想Try參數
並不難...

現在的網站大多數不使用內置框架
尤其是比較有規模的網站幾乎如此
反而是把網頁切成一塊一塊的
利用呼叫檔案的方式串起來居多
對於維護上
只要把那些常用的區塊切出來
修改上就比較方便了

其實現在寫程式
操作流程上需要比較注意到使用者的操作習慣
以及便利性
對很多使用者來說
他們只在乎好不好用
至於安全性問題
那得請Coding人員自己想辦法解決

坦白說
一般使用者並不會去考慮程設人員所考慮的安全性以及其他問題
他們只願意看到表面上的問題
好不好用?
快不快?

怎樣去取決怎樣做
我想這需要去溝通了

參數問題
我認為本身就該注意了
如何去防止被人惡意Try參數
用框架頁或者是內置框架
都只是表面上的作法
真的有漏洞還是很好找出來的

最大的問題
框架這東西真的不是很好調整美觀度以及瀏覽便利性
能少用就少用吧

[桂正和 在  2007-2-26 10:06 PM 作了最後編輯]



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  訪問主頁  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
ROACH
版主
等級: 30等級: 30等級: 30等級: 30等級: 30等級: 30等級: 30等級: 30
減肥中!請勿餵食

十週年紀念徽章(四級)  

 . 積分: 15118
 . 精華: 14
 . 文章: 11766
 . 收花: 140844 支
 . 送花: 6005 支
 . 比例: 0.04
 . 在線: 8869 小時
 . 瀏覽: 85616 頁
 . 註冊: 7994
 . 失蹤: 7
 . 鄉下地方
#9 : 2007-3-14 12:26 PM     只看本作者 引言回覆

我後來是用的jsp的include這個作法
這樣就用參數的方式把那個jsp網頁給include進來的

<%
<jsp:include page="<%=url%>">
  <jsp:param name="s" value="<%=s%>" />
  <jsp:param name="t" value="0" />
  <jsp:param name="n" value="<%=nn%>" />
    <jsp:param name="tar" value="<%=tar%>" />
</jsp:include>
%>



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  訪問主頁  發私人訊息  Blog  快速回覆 新增/修改 爬文標記
ithinkurdumb
開墾隊隊員
等級: 11等級: 11等級: 11等級: 11
(見下圖)

 . 積分: 326
 . 文章: 574
 . 收花: 2842 支
 . 送花: 381 支
 . 比例: 0.13
 . 在線: 495 小時
 . 瀏覽: 4740 頁
 . 註冊: 7026
 . 失蹤: 495
 . Taipei
#10 : 2007-3-14 01:44 PM     只看本作者 引言回覆

iframe為什麼會不容易保持美觀呢?
狠多日系網站都是透過iframe來呈現的.
有可能不美觀的應該是frameset吧?

至於便利性,
用iframe的網頁真的不方便加bookmark就是了.



[如果你喜歡本文章,就按本文章之鮮花~送花給作者吧,你的支持就是別人的動力來源]
本文連接  
檢閱個人資料  發私人訊息  Blog  快速回覆 新增/修改 爬文標記

   

快速回覆
表情符號

更多 Smilies

字型大小 : |||      [完成後可按 Ctrl+Enter 發佈]        

溫馨提示:本區開放遊客瀏覽。
選項:
關閉 URL 識別    關閉 表情符號    關閉 Discuz! 代碼    使用個人簽名    接收新回覆信件通知
發表時自動複製內容   [立即複製] (IE only)


 



所在時區為 GMT+8, 現在時間是 2024-4-19 03:53 PM
清除 Cookies - 連絡我們 - TWed2k © 2001-2046 - 純文字版 - 說明
Discuz! 0.1 | Processed in 0.028804 second(s), 6 queries , Qzip disabled